Config :: crontab.

config :: crontab ist ein Perl-Modul, mit dem Vixie kompatible Crontab-Dateien gelesen / schreiben.
Jetzt downloaden

Config :: crontab. Ranking & Zusammenfassung

Anzeige

  • Rating:
  • Lizenz:
  • Perl Artistic License
  • Preis:
  • FREE
  • Name des Herausgebers:
  • Scott Wiersdorf
  • Website des Verlags:
  • http://search.cpan.org/~scottw/

Config :: crontab. Stichworte


Config :: crontab. Beschreibung

Config :: crontab ist ein Perl-Modul, das zum Lesen / Schreiben von Vixie-kompatiblen Crontab-Dateien verwendet wird. Config :: crontab ist ein Perl-Modul, das zum Lesen / Schreiben von Vixie-kompatiblen Crontab-Dateien verwendet wird.Synopsis Verwenden Sie Config :: Crontab; ######################################### ## Erstellen Sie einen neuen Crontab von Scratch ###### ############################# MY $ CT = NEUE CONFIG :: crontab; ## Erstellen Sie ein neues Blockobjekt MY $ block = NEUE CONFIG :: CRONTAB :: Block (-Data => Last ($ block); ## einen anderen Block mithilfe von Blockmethoden $ block = NEUE CONFIG :: crontab :: block; $ block-> Last (NEUE CONFIG :: CRONTAB :: COMMENTA (-Data => '## Do Backups')); $ block-> Last (NEUE CONFIG :: crontab :: env (-Name => 'mailto' , -Value => 'Bob')); $ block-> Last (Neue Konfiguration :: Crontab :: Event (-Minute => 40, -HROUR => 3, -Command => '/ SBIN / Backup --Partition = ALL ')); Fügen Sie diesen Block in Crontab-Datei $ CT-> Last ($ BLOCK); ##, schreiben Sie die Crontab-Datei $ CT-> Write; ###################### Wechseln Sie einen vorhandenen Crontab ####################################################################################################### #### My $ ct = new config :: crontab; $ ct-> Lesen; ## Kommentieren Sie den Befehl, der unser Backup $ _-> aktiv (0) für $ ct-> auswählen (-command_re => / sbin / backup '); speichern Sie unseren Crontab erneut $ CT-> Write; ############################################# ## Lesen von Joe's Crontab (Muss-Wurzelberechtigungen verfügen) ##################################### # S ident identy as "crontab -u Joe -l "My $ ct = new config :: crontab (-Owner = > 'Joe'); $ ct-> Lesen; ein config :: crontab-Objekt ermöglicht es Ihnen, einen bestellten Satz von Ereignis-, ENV- oder Kommentarobjekten zu manipulieren (auch in diesem Paket enthalten). Die Beschreibungen dieser Pakete finden Sie unten. Die allgemeine Idee ist, dass Sie ein Config :: Crontab-Objekt erstellen und es mit einer Datei verknüpfen (falls nicht zugewiesen (falls nicht behandelt), wird es über ein Rohr zu Crontab -l) funktioniert). Von dort aus können Sie Zeilen zu Ihrem Crontab-Objekt hinzufügen, vorhandene Zeilenattribute ändern und alles schreiben. .). Wenn der Anruf an Crontab nicht fehlschlägt, wenn Sie schreiben, schreibt das Schreiben und setzt den Fehler mit der Fehlermeldung mit der vom Crontab-Befehl zurückgegebenen Fehlermeldung zurück. Die zukünftige Entwicklung kann sich auf mehr Gültigkeitsprüfungen tendieren. Navigieren Sie auf den Ins und den Outs der Moduls, um die Moduls und Outs erfolgreich zu navigieren, werden wir eine kleine Terminologiestunde benötigen. Anforderungen: · Perl.


Config :: crontab. Zugehörige Software